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-64374

Not All Site Administration Pages Can be Bookmarked when using the Boost theme

    XMLWordPrintable

    Details

    • Affected Branches:
      MOODLE_36_STABLE, MOODLE_37_STABLE

      Description

      When utilizing the "Admin Bookmarks" functionality which lets you "Bookmark This Page", there are several administration pages which you don't get this option for.  Realistically because the "Bookmark This Page" is part of the Admin Bookmarks block which eats up space, I am sure it isn't displayed there for space concerns.  And while I don't need the "Admin Bookmarks" block shown on these pages themselves, it would be nice to add the pages themselves to my admin bookmark list so that I can quickly jump there.

      Specific pages:

      Add a New Course (from Courses Node)

      Manage Courses and Categories (from Courses Node)

      Default Dashboard Page (from Appearances Node)

      Default Profile Page (from Appearances Node)

       

      Also, attempting to bookmark User Tours results in "Invalid Section" error.

       

      Initially reported here and asked to create Tracker item by Helen Foster.

      https://moodle.org/mod/forum/discuss.php?d=379674

       ----

      Steps to reproduce (using the Boost theme):

      1. Log in as an admin and go to the Site administration
      2. Click the button 'Blocks editing on'
      3. Go to one of the pages mentioned above

      Expected result: The Admin bookmarks block is displayed with a link 'Bookmark this page'.

      Actual result: The Admin bookmarks block is not displayed so there is no option to bookmark the page.

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                Unassigned
                Reporter:
                shardwic Scott Hardwick
                Participants:
                Component watchers:
                Andrew Nicols, Mathew May, Michael Hawkins, Shamim Rezaie, Simey Lameze, Adrian Greeve, Mihail Geshoski, Peter Dias, Jake Dallimore, Jun Pataleta, Ryan Wyllie
              • Votes:
                0 Vote for this issue
                Watchers:
                4 Start watching this issue

                Dates

                • Created:
                  Updated: